What companies run services between London Eye, England and Spitalfields, England?

London Underground (Tube) operates a subway from Embankment station to Aldgate East station every 5 minutes. Tickets cost £2–7 and the journey takes 11 min. Alternatively, National Express operates a bus from London Eye to Liverpool Street Station every 30 minutes. Tickets cost £1–2 and the journey takes 19 min.
